Bitcoin Block 306346

Bitcoin Block 306,346 was mined on and contains 217 transactions. Miners collected 0.04273496 BTC in transaction fees with a block reward of 25.04273496 BTC. Block size: 255.62 KB.

Block Details

Hash0000000000000000416e77cba50a9881bb4acc04f043690ed002e62aa2447ba3
Timestamp
Transactions217
AddressesView addresses
Size255.62 KB
Weight1,022,468 WU
Total fees0.04273496 BTC
Avg fee rate16.7 sat/vB
Block reward25.04273496 BTC
Inputs / Outputs1,309 / 1,151
Difficulty1.18e+10
Merkle root78664757fad9682d295d3bb48f175dba63e173b330f393adc8cab3bf377e643d
Nonce2,716,734,967
Version0x00000002
Previous block00000000000000000c43856210780c355994de25651c223cd6a138f17b4065ec
Next blockBlock 306347 →

Block Visualization

Block Statistics

See how this block compares to network trends: